Waylon never took much to the Outlaw label, although he looked and acted every bit the part. But his insistence on artistic control, recording with his own band, and writing or choosing his own songs blazed a trail for many younger artists to follow. When Hoss hit the stage with The Waylors, it might as well have been midnight in a Texas roadhouse for all anybody could tell.
